#a0ce95 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#a0ce95 is composed of 62.7% red, 80.8%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 27.7%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 108.4 degrees, a saturation of 36.8% and a lightness of 69.6%. #a0ce95 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#419d2b. Closest websafe color is: #99cc99.

● #a0ce95 color description : Slightly desaturated lime green.
The hexadecimal color #a0ce95 has RGB values of R:160, G:206, B:149 and CMYK values of C:0.22, M:0, Y:0.28,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 10538645.
